Connecting a Component Video Input
1.
Connect the UDM-HD15RCA3 Breakout Cable (FG-HD15RCA3, not included) to the video source
device’s Component video output connectors (Red, Green and Blue).
2. Attach the other end of the cable to the appropriate VIDEO IN connector (A-H) on the UDM.
3. Connect the source audio to the analog (RCA) audio jacks, or digital (SPDIF) Input connector.
Connecting an S-Video Input
1.
Connect the UDM-SVID01 HD15 to SVideo Cable (FG-UDM-SVID01, not included) to the video
source’s S-Video connection.
2. Attach the other end of the cable to the appropriate VIDEO IN connector (A-H) on the UDM.
3. Connect source audio to the analog (RCA) audio jacks, or digital (SPDIF) Input connector.

Audio & Video Formats/Resolutions/Distance
The following table provides recommended maximum distances for cable runs, based on video class type at
various resolutions:
It is important to note that the maximum distances indicated above are not absolute, but are recommended
distances that have been tested to deliver video at the specified resolutions, without significant signal
degradation. In particular, lower resolutions (640 x 480, 720 x 480 and 800 x 600) can often be delivered
significantly further than what is indicated in the table.
Several factors affect the overall quality of the displayed video, including the quality of the twisted pair cable
and connectors used, the nature of the video image itself, as well as the particulars of the installation and how
the video is displayed and viewed.

Audio & Video Formats/Resolutions/Distance
Class Format Name UDM-RX02N
Composite/S-Video 720 x 480 NTSC 300 m / 1000’
720 x 576 PAL 300 m / 1000’
Component 720 x 480 480p 300 m / 1000’
720 x 576 576p 300 m / 1000’
1280 x 720 720p 300 m / 1000’
1920 x 1080 1080i 300 m / 1000’
1920 x 1080 1080p 300 m / 1000’
RGBHV 640 x 480 VGA 300 m / 1000’ *
800 x 600 SVGA 300 m / 1000’ *
1024 x 768 XGA 300 m / 1000’ *
1280 x 1024 SXGA 300 m / 1000’ *
1600 x 1200 UXGA 140 m / 460’
1920 x 1080 HD 140 m / 460’
* When using VGA modes with audio enabled, the
maximum cable distance is approximately 200 m / 650’ (UDM-RX02N).
